Fix collectors does not returns ext-metadata

This commit is contained in:
Takeshi KOMIYA 2017-03-13 10:46:07 +09:00
parent 46244ae9f8
commit 75c7c80299
6 changed files with 46 additions and 10 deletions

View File

@ -143,6 +143,12 @@ class DownloadFileCollector(EnvironmentCollector):
def setup(app): def setup(app):
# type: (Sphinx) -> None # type: (Sphinx) -> Dict
app.add_env_collector(ImageCollector) app.add_env_collector(ImageCollector)
app.add_env_collector(DownloadFileCollector) app.add_env_collector(DownloadFileCollector)
return {
'version': 'builtin',
'parallel_read_safe': True,
'parallel_write_safe': True,
}

View File

@ -18,7 +18,7 @@ from sphinx.environment.collectors import EnvironmentCollector
if False: if False:
# For type annotation # For type annotation
from typing import Set # NOQA from typing import Dict, Set # NOQA
from docutils import nodes # NOQA from docutils import nodes # NOQA
from sphinx.sphinx import Sphinx # NOQA from sphinx.sphinx import Sphinx # NOQA
from sphinx.environment import BuildEnvironment # NOQA from sphinx.environment import BuildEnvironment # NOQA
@ -56,5 +56,11 @@ class DependenciesCollector(EnvironmentCollector):
def setup(app): def setup(app):
# type: (Sphinx) -> None # type: (Sphinx) -> Dict
app.add_env_collector(DependenciesCollector) app.add_env_collector(DependenciesCollector)
return {
'version': 'builtin',
'parallel_read_safe': True,
'parallel_write_safe': True,
}

View File

@ -15,7 +15,7 @@ from sphinx.environment.collectors import EnvironmentCollector
if False: if False:
# For type annotation # For type annotation
from typing import Set # NOQA from typing import Dict, Set # NOQA
from docutils import nodes # NOQA from docutils import nodes # NOQA
from sphinx.applicatin import Sphinx # NOQA from sphinx.applicatin import Sphinx # NOQA
from sphinx.environment import BuildEnvironment # NOQA from sphinx.environment import BuildEnvironment # NOQA
@ -56,5 +56,11 @@ class IndexEntriesCollector(EnvironmentCollector):
def setup(app): def setup(app):
# type: (Sphinx) -> None # type: (Sphinx) -> Dict
app.add_env_collector(IndexEntriesCollector) app.add_env_collector(IndexEntriesCollector)
return {
'version': 'builtin',
'parallel_read_safe': True,
'parallel_write_safe': True,
}

View File

@ -15,7 +15,7 @@ from sphinx.environment.collectors import EnvironmentCollector
if False: if False:
# For type annotation # For type annotation
from typing import Set # NOQA from typing import Dict, Set # NOQA
from docutils import nodes # NOQA from docutils import nodes # NOQA
from sphinx.sphinx import Sphinx # NOQA from sphinx.sphinx import Sphinx # NOQA
from sphinx.environment import BuildEnvironment # NOQA from sphinx.environment import BuildEnvironment # NOQA
@ -69,5 +69,11 @@ class MetadataCollector(EnvironmentCollector):
def setup(app): def setup(app):
# type: (Sphinx) -> None # type: (Sphinx) -> Dict
app.add_env_collector(MetadataCollector) app.add_env_collector(MetadataCollector)
return {
'version': 'builtin',
'parallel_read_safe': True,
'parallel_write_safe': True,
}

View File

@ -16,7 +16,7 @@ from sphinx.transforms import SphinxContentsFilter
if False: if False:
# For type annotation # For type annotation
from typing import Set # NOQA from typing import Dict, Set # NOQA
from docutils import nodes # NOQA from docutils import nodes # NOQA
from sphinx.sphinx import Sphinx # NOQA from sphinx.sphinx import Sphinx # NOQA
from sphinx.environment import BuildEnvironment # NOQA from sphinx.environment import BuildEnvironment # NOQA
@ -62,5 +62,11 @@ class TitleCollector(EnvironmentCollector):
def setup(app): def setup(app):
# type: (Sphinx) -> None # type: (Sphinx) -> Dict
app.add_env_collector(TitleCollector) app.add_env_collector(TitleCollector)
return {
'version': 'builtin',
'parallel_read_safe': True,
'parallel_write_safe': True,
}

View File

@ -284,5 +284,11 @@ class TocTreeCollector(EnvironmentCollector):
def setup(app): def setup(app):
# type: (Sphinx) -> None # type: (Sphinx) -> Dict
app.add_env_collector(TocTreeCollector) app.add_env_collector(TocTreeCollector)
return {
'version': 'builtin',
'parallel_read_safe': True,
'parallel_write_safe': True,
}